This incredibly cute, cozy, clean, modern and comfortable guest house is in a fantastic and convenient location (in Recoleta, two blocks from the Tribunales subte stop, 3 blocks from the Obelisk, Walking distance from many museums and tourist sites. This is great for grad students and adventurers/explorers of the world. 4 big rooms with plenty of light, 3 shared bathrooms - hot water. Our four high-ceiling rooms with wood floors are spacious and have air conditioning. Every room has a Wi-Fi connection, breakfast table, cleaning and room service, change of linen and access to a balcony. more » « less
